    This place is awesome! I should have probably waited until the end to give the punchline but it really is. When walking thru the double doors you are taken back to and older generation. It's clear as day to that this restaurant is decades old, if the cash register doesnt give it away. The food is amazing and the rolls are out of this world. I had the stuffed pepper app. along with the Blackened Strip (12 oz) cooked medium which was perfect. I had a baked potato and a side of asparagus along with my steak. The steak had the perfect taste and the asparagus was cooked perfectly. The price is great and the service is just as good as the food. We had a small chat with the one of the ladies at the bar (maybe the owner). She said she has been there since the 60s. If you are ever passing thru Franklin, Cranberry, Oil City be sure to stop for dinner. The menu has everything; steak, chicken, sea food, veal, pasta. You won't be disappointed! Next time I am up here for work I will be back at the Yellow Dog.

    SETTING: After trekking through frozen sidewalks, puddles of doom, and mountains of snow mush on a particularly awful snow day, we finally arrived at our destination. Our pants were soaked and our toes frozen from the ice water that seeped through our shoes. Right when we reached for the door, a woman inside warmly welcomed us in, "You boys made it!" I felt like we were transported into a ski lodge. Dark wood and dark furniture. Everything was dimly lit and created a more fancy sit-down atmosphere. Looks like a house was converted into this restaurant. FOOD: I got the Black and Blue--a large piece of NY strip steak with melted bleu cheese crumbles on top. Each entree came with a fresh dinner roll, salad, and a side. The steak was well prepared, and did I mention, LARGE? In Pittsburgh, I would get half that size while paying the same price. So. Much. Meat. If you know me at all, you know I ate it all. This boy cleans up! SERVICE: A bit slow, but seems like everything is made once it is ordered and to a very good quality. The women working there were so sweet. I'm a sucker for smiles and warm personalities. I think this is a family run restaurant too, which adds to the charm. IMPRESSIONS: For the price, this place is solid. It's a cute date spot if you're in the area. It's incredible how much $$$ can differ when comparing dining experiences at small towns to big cities. Thanks for taking care of us when we visited that one cold night!
